Burnley manager Sean Dyche is not taking a look at the Premier League table just yet.

The Clarets are flying high after back to back wins in the league.

It has put them above the likes of Arsenal and Manchester United in seventh place.

But given the close points proximity of teams in mid-table, Dyche knows that his side must continue to focus on each game at a time.

"We have been in this territory a couple of years ago but last year was a reminder of how difficult the Premier League is," said Dyche to reporters.

"I don't get carried away with it and I don't think my players get carried away with it.

"But it is there to be enjoyed because it is tough in the Premier League.

"It is great for our fans who came down here but we have a lot of work to do. It is the story of a season. I said that last year when things weren't going so well and we managed to finish strongly and I am still saying it now because I am not naive enough to think being where we are now is a given.

"It doesn't work like that, I wish it did. It would be handy if they blew the whistle now! I would take it."
